Microsoft Power BI DAX

This is an advanced course for people who already have experience developing Power BI reports and want to develop their proficiency using DAX.

DAX allows us to enrich our data model and perform highly sophisticated data analysis, but there is some theory required to master DAX. In this course we delve into key concepts like evaluation context while also introducing best practise like the use of variables.

The course will also cover a wide range of DAX functions including Iterator, Table, Calculate and Calculate Modifier functions, Timeseries Intelligence and Hierarchy functions.

DAX AND TEH DATA MODEL
  • Power BI Options
  • Create a Data Model
  • Manage Relationships
  • DAX Operators
DAX FUNDAMENTALS
  • Create a Fiscal Calendar
  • ADDCOLUMNS
  • Understand Variables
  • Add Comments
  • DAX Formatter
  • Date & Text Functions
  • IF and SWITCH
MEASURES
  • Why Measures
  • Simple Measures
  • Row vs Filter Context
  • Create a Measures Table
ITERATORS
  • Understand Iterators
  • SUMX
  • AVERAGEX
  • RELATED
  • CONCATENATEX
TABLE FUNCTIONS
  • VALUES
  • ALL & ALLEXCEPT
  • SUMMARISE
  • FILTER
DAX TOOLS
  • Query View
  • DAX Studio
  • EVALUATE syntax
  • Performance Analyser
CALCULATE
  • Understand CALCULATE
  • Multiple Criteria
  • Calculate Modifiers
  • Calculation Sequence
TIME INTELLIGENCE
  • TOTALYTD & DATESYTD
  • SAMEPERIODLASTYEAR
  • DATEADD
  • PARALLELPERIOD
HIERARCHY FUNCTIONS
  • PATH & PATHCONTAINS
  • Dynamic RLS
